This version of Picaresque comes as a 1xCD. - In the past two years, The Decemberists have gone from unknowns outside their native Portland to success via critical praise, impressive sales, and packed houses. This is their fullest sounding releae yet. They blaze through more instrumental variations than can be listed here for a heightened urgency and depth to the sharply written lyrical scenarios.Recorded August-September 2004 at the Prescott Church, Portland, Oregon and Hall Of Justice, Seattle, Washington.
Mixed at Avast!, Seattle, Washington.
Mastered at RFI.
"Picaresque" is the third studio album by The Decemberists, released in 2005 on CD format by Kill Rock Stars. This critically acclaimed record showcases the band's signature blend of indie rock and folk influences, featuring storytelling lyrics and lush instrumentation. Standout tracks like "The Infanta," "16 Military Wives," and "We Both Go Down Together" highlight their narrative prowess and musical creativity. The Decemberists, formed in Portland, Oregon, are known for their literary songwriting style led by frontman Colin Meloy. Over the years, they have achieved significant success with albums such as "The Crane Wife" and "The King Is Dead," earning a dedicated fanbase worldwide. Kill Rock Stars is an independent label renowned for supporting innovative artists across genres since its founding in 1991; it has played a pivotal role in launching influential acts within alternative music. |
